PLEASE HELP !!!!! Which set of line segments with the given lengths form a right triangle? 9, 27, 81 10, 24, 38 14, 16, 22 15, 36, 39

OpenStudy (anonymous):

15.36,39

OpenStudy (anonymous):

(15x15)+(36x36)=(39x39) 225+1296=1521 1521=1521 therefore D forms a right triangle
